网站爬虫生成,技术解析与实际应用
随着互联网的快速发展,数据已经成为企业、政府和个人不可或缺的重要资源,而网站爬虫作为一种高效的数据采集工具,在各个领域都得到了广泛应用,本文将深入解析网站爬虫的生成原理,并探讨其在实际应用中的价值。
网站爬虫生成原理
1、爬虫架构
网站爬虫主要由三个部分组成:爬虫引擎、数据解析器和数据存储。
(1)爬虫引擎:负责发起请求、获取网页内容、解析网页链接等操作。
(2)数据解析器:负责解析网页内容,提取所需数据。
(3)数据存储:负责将提取的数据存储到数据库或其他存储系统中。
2、爬虫类型
根据工作方式,网站爬虫可分为以下几种类型:
(1)通用爬虫:以搜索引擎为代表,旨在爬取尽可能多的网页,为用户提供搜索服务。
(2)垂直爬虫:针对特定领域或行业,爬取相关网页,为用户提供专业信息。
(3)深度爬虫:针对特定网页或网站,深入挖掘其内容,提取有价值的信息。
3、爬虫生成过程
(1)确定爬取目标:根据需求,确定爬取的网站、页面类型和关键词等。
(2)构建爬虫架构:根据目标,设计爬虫引擎、数据解析器和数据存储等模块。
(3)编写爬虫代码:使用Python、Java等编程语言,实现爬虫的各个功能。
(4)测试与优化:对爬虫进行测试,确保其正常运行,并根据实际情况进行优化。
网站爬虫实际应用
1、数据采集与挖掘
网站爬虫可以高效地采集互联网上的各类数据,为数据挖掘、机器学习等应用提供数据基础。
2、搜索引擎优化(SEO)
通过爬虫技术,企业可以了解自身网站在搜索引擎中的排名,针对性地优化网站结构和内容,提高网站曝光度。
3、行业分析
网站爬虫可以采集行业动态、竞争对手信息等数据,为企业提供决策依据。
4、网络舆情监测
爬虫技术可以实时监测网络舆情,为企业、政府等提供舆情分析报告。
5、社交网络分析
通过爬虫技术,可以分析社交网络中的用户行为、兴趣爱好等,为企业提供精准营销策略。
网站爬虫作为一种高效的数据采集工具,在各个领域都发挥着重要作用,了解网站爬虫的生成原理和实际应用,有助于我们更好地利用这一技术,为企业和个人创造价值,在今后的工作中,我们需要不断优化爬虫技术,提高数据采集的准确性和效率,以满足日益增长的数据需求。
相关文章

最新评论